More details have leaked about an upcoming LEGO set based on the Great Deku Tree from The Legend of Zelda series. Some of these details were heard previously via past rumors about the set, now further corroborated by German LEGO blog Bricktastic, and shared via Video Games Chronicle.

According to the recent reports, the Great Deku Tree set will be released on September 1, 2024. It will cost 300 Euros, which is about $325 USD. The set will consist of 2,500 pieces, and you’ll be able to use those pieces to build two different variations of the Deku Tree - one inspired by its appearance in The Ocarina of Time, the other in Breath of the Wild. Both builds will rest on a black plate with a Zelda logo, but the shape and features (such as green leaves vs. pink leaves) will differ.

You won’t be able to build both versions at the same time with just one set. It also sounds like the set will include minifigures of Classic Link, Young Link, Breath of the Wild Link and Breath of the Wild Zelda, plus a Hylian Shield and Ocarina.

We still don’t have an official confirmation for any of this, but based on the repeated leaks from reliable sources, it’s probably safe to assume that most of this information will come true. We’ll see what happens!
